Planning application
LA01/2026/0295/F
63 Market Street, Ballycastle
Proposal
Extension of existing dwelling through the change of use of an adjoining ground floor shop to domestic accommodation and the erection of garden wall and railings to the front of the property (Amended Certificate & Plans)

What happens while it is decided
The process from here
This application is with Causeway Coast and Glens for determination. The council publicises it, consults neighbours and technical bodies where required, and weighs the responses against local and national planning policy.
The statutory target is eight weeks for most applications and thirteen for major development, though extensions of time are common. Comments carry most weight while the case is undecided, so check the council portal for the deadline if you want to respond.

How this application type works
A full application seeks permission for a complete, detailed proposal in one go: siting, design, access and landscaping are all fixed at this stage. It is the standard route for new buildings, conversions and changes of use. The statutory target is eight weeks for smaller schemes and thirteen weeks for major development, though complex cases often take longer by agreement.
